Output 63cf89daf76e69178b51fd6e2fced586ae1fff89f6dd483c62bfe91e27b5321b:1

value
758555801570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23ce94e76f96bd487d0e89d6ec325d015e0e3176 OP_EQUALVERIFY OP_CHECKSIG
address
D8QRfWyZ1Tzr6orC4DS8eRaCWDubEu9aEU
transaction
63cf89daf76e69178b51fd6e2fced586ae1fff89f6dd483c62bfe91e27b5321b